Teacher Talk is essential in teaching activities, which attracts the scholars at homeand abroad to study deeper and deeper from various areas. With the development ofInternet technology, online open courses become more and more popular in recent years.However, rare research on Teacher Talk is in this new kind of courses. As a result, thispaper adopts Martin’s Appraisal Theory as theoretical framework to analyse HarvardPositive Psychology, in order to explore the features of Teacher Talk and how itaccomplishes interpersonal functions during the classes.This thesis adopts qualitative and quantitative method to analyse ten lectures ofPositive Psychology for the sake of studying the distribution of the three resources,analysing their features and exploring reasons of the phenomenon. It is discovered that theAttitudinal resources are used most, followed by Graduation, and the relatively least usedis Engagement resources. The distribution of the three Appraisal resources are utiliseddifferently in various classroom activities. The possible reasons are that this course isabout psychology which is much concerned with Affect, Judgement and Appreciation; theuse of Engagement resources could enhance the credibility of teacher’s remarks, andcultivate critical and divergent thinking style of the students; Graduation resourcespenetrate into Attitude and Engagement resources, the more Force resources activate theatmosphere of the class. The three kinds of resources work together in different classroomactivities to strengthen the interest of the lectures and improve the interpersonalrelationship between the teacher and the students.This paper widened the research scope of Teacher Talk, and proved the strongexplanation of Appraisal Theory in the newly-developing online open courses, as well asthe guiding significance on teaching. Due to the limitation of time and space, the thesisonly analysed one kind of online open courses. As a result, the research area is narrowwith not enough persuasion. Therefore, it is not mature enough, which still needs morescholars to enrich and complete this research.
